    Overview The Economics program of The University of North Carolina at Charlotte explores the economic decisions of individuals, businesses, governments, and other institutions. It examines the nature of economic activity, why it takes place, and how it affects everyone’s lives. The program includes elective courses that enable students to tailor their educational program to meet personal needs and interests. The study of economics also helps students develop a way of thinking that is logical and rigorous. It provides decision-making tools that they can apply to personal as well as business decisions and use to address the many economic decisions they will face in the future.Degree ProgramsThe Department of Economics offers two programs leading to the Bachelor of Science degree. Students who plan to pursue careers in business-related fields such as banking, finance, and international commerce, or who plan to enter an MBA program, are encouraged to elect the Major in Economics with a Business Concentration program. Students planning to pursue a career in education or the social sciences, enter graduate school in economics, or attend law school are encouraged to pursue the Major in Economics with a Liberal Arts Concentration.     The study in the Economics program of The University of North Carolina at Charlotte offers students a problem-solving discipline to foster their intellectual and career development. It provides students with a balanced and broad educational background and prepares them to choose from a wide range of career alternatives.

    Requirements

    Other Requirements

    • 1 : Minimum GPA:  2.5 overall and 2.5 in Progression Courses listed belowPre-Major/Prerequisite/Progression Courses: Writing and Inquiry in Academic Contexts I and II, Writing and Inquiry in Academic Contexts I and II with Studio, Principles of Economics - Macro, Principles of Economics - Micro, Introduction to Business Computing, Calculus, Calculus for Engineering Technology, Elements of Statistics I (BUSN), Elements of Statistics I, Introduction to Statistics, Introduction to Probability and Statistics, Principles of Accounting I & II, Introduction to Business and Professional DevelopmentApplication and Application Fee of $80Submit one required essayProof of English abilityOfficial School RecordsSAT or ACT score
